How to Apply for Distance Learning Programs and Courses
To be admitted into a Distance Learning Program (DLP) within the HGTC Distance Learning Institute (DLi) you must complete the following process:
I. Be Admitted to the College
- Submit an Application
Complete and submit the online application to the College. - Begin the Financial Aid Process
No matter how you intend to pay for tuition and fees, begin the Financial Aid application process when you apply to HGTC. Learn More about Financial Aid - Submit Transcripts
Request that your high school and/or college(s) mail an official transcript to the HGTC Admissions Office. - Complete any Additional Admissions Requirements
Some academic programs have additional requirements, such as background checks and physical-ability assessments.
II. Complete the Distance Learning Institute Student Survey
Upon acceptance into a Distance Learning Program, you will receive information and
link to the DLi survey.
III. Complete the DLi Orientation
A part of the DLi admission requirements, you must complete an online orientation
with important facts about distance learning at HGTC and more information about your
program.
IV. See your DLi Advisor
With the help of your distance learning advisor, you will learn what courses you need
to take and will receive help in registering for your courses.
